Embracing SD-WAN Technology: The Evolution from Hardware to Software in Networking

While the shift from hardware to software solutions is familiar to technology professionals, network infrastructure has traditionally remained hardware-centric, even as applications increasingly move to the cloud. Enter SD-WAN (Software-Defined Wide Area Networks), a transformative approach requiring IT teams to rethink network flexibility and security. Unlike MPLS (Multiprotocol Label Switching), a decades-old yet reliable and costly connectivity option, SD-WAN Technology offers modern businesses the agility, scalability, security, and efficiency needed in today’s fast-paced environment.

Understanding SD-WAN Basics

At its core, SD-WAN integrates various networks efficiently, whether internal, external, or cloud-based. Unlike rigid WAN setups, SD-WAN enables centralized configuration, reducing human errors that can disrupt productivity. This software-driven model allows organizations to scale quickly and add remote locations without significant investments in hardware or time-intensive redesigns.

Managing Software-Defined Networks

SD-WAN Technology simplifies network management by providing a centralized dashboard for both local and global adjustments. This setup ensures consistent security standards across all locations and accelerates troubleshooting by consolidating error reporting. IT teams can swiftly address network hotspots and allocate resources to enhance speed and efficiency—all seamlessly, ensuring uninterrupted user experiences.

Business Benefits of SD-WAN

Switching to SD-WAN delivers immediate and long-term advantages:

  • Cost Efficiency: SD-WAN connectivity is more affordable than MPLS, accommodating bandwidth-heavy applications.
  • Ease of Management: While initial setup requires expertise, ongoing adjustments are less complex, reducing future consulting costs.
  • High Availability: Network updates don’t require downtime, ensuring uninterrupted access.
  • Business Alignment: Network rules align with business needs, simplifying maintenance and understanding.
  • Adaptability: SD-WAN supports the growing reliance on cloud-based applications and provides uniform security across SaaS and traditional systems.
  • Improved User Experience: Remote workers and branches enjoy seamless, high-quality connections without latency or restrictive procedures.

Ideal Use Cases for SD-WAN

Organizations seeking cost-effective connectivity, scalability, and flexible solutions benefit significantly from SD-WAN. While some heavy applications may require MPLS to avoid packet loss, hybrid setups combining SD-WAN and MPLS can address these needs.
